Unit test visual studio express for mac

Start writing unit test with visual studio for mac. Or, you can run tests by selecting one or more tests or groups, rightclicking, and selecting run selected tests from the shortcut menu. Your subscription will not be renewed until you activate it. You can use the same process to debug code using your unit test project.

The problem is, that the default installation of visual studio for mac does not discover these xunit tests even if you do a full rebuild. Intellisense describes apis as you type and uses autocompletion to increase the speed and accuracy of how you write code. Visual studio ide offers many advantages for developers. This tutorial demonstrates how to build and debug linux applications using visual studio. Filtering you can filter the autocompletion list by pressing the ctrl key while the members list menu is open. Rerun unit tests when you make changes to test that your code is still working correctly.

Macincloud supports the latest microsoft visual studio for mac with xamarin components. These build tools allow you to build visual studio projects from a commandline interface. Get started right away managed server plan and dedicated build server plan have microsoft visual studio community and xamarin community for mac configured see the latest versions in action login and access the latest development tools. Or, for the nunit and xunit test frameworks, visual studio includes preconfigured test project templates that include the necessary nuget packages. It supports all versions of vs2012, vs20, vs2015 and vs2017. Net ecosystem of code, libraries and tools to develop or port applications to linux, unix or mac os x. Agents for visual studio 2019 can be used for load, functional, and automated testing. Visual studio 2019 brings you the latest personal and team productivity features, support for modern developmentwhether thats.

The visual studio code editor has builtin debugging support for the node. You can run the tests by clicking the run all link in test explorer. The corner status spinner and coverage marker customisations are not supported under vs2008. What are the top features commonly found in most it management software solutions. Writing tests is important, so i decided to try out nunit in.

However, the file name must match exactly as visual studio for mac and monodevelop do not allow you to select any. Specifically, eric will jump into how the open source test framework slacker works with ssdt, sql server 2016 or sql database on azure and visual studio 2017 to enable database unit testing. So every time you add a new test case of type coded ui you will be provided with this dialog box. You can run tests in visual studio 2017 or from the command line. Unit tests not discovered in visual studio 2017 stack. We purposely compartmentalized the instructions for creating the test cases, to experiment with them separately. To proceed with the tutorial you will need a windows machine and a linux machine. Learn how to create an application with visual basic using our visual studio tutorials. Older versions of visual studio express do not support 3rd party vs packages such as ncrunch. Net, javascript, crossplatform app development and beyond news and tutorials. As soon as you click ok in the dialog box your visual studio will be minimized with a tray that appears on the bottomright of your screen.

Get access to developer tools, azure, devtest software, support and training. Download visual studio community, professional, and enterprise. Rightclick on the solution in solution explorer and choose add new project. Unit testing javascript and typescript visual studio. Its a complete package to build your next great app for any platform with the power of visual studio and the rich benefits from your subscription. Visualgdb serious crossplatform support for visual studio. There appear to be bugs in visual studio not detecting changes to projects when you edit them.

It supports building, debugging and provides a powerful intellisense engine. That simplifies step 1 of making visual studio 2012 usable. Microsoft visual studio express is a set of integrated development environments ides developed by microsoft as a freeware and registerware functionlimited version of the nonfree microsoft visual studio. Developing django apps in visual studio scott hanselman. Or just click the run all button in the unit tests pad. Open the project that you want to test in visual studio. You can use 2 physical computers, a windows computer running linux inside virtualboxvmware or vice versa. With the support from the java test runner extension, you can easily run, debug, and manage your junit and testng test cases. Today, im happy to announce that we will add visual studio express 2012 for windows desktop to the visual studio 2012 family. It is added automatically to all unit test projects by visual studio to help it quickly find projects with tests.

Visual studio lets you use a single window to run and debug tests and see test. Visual studio installs the microsoft unit testing frameworks for managed and native code. You see, now i dont have to leave my favorite environment visual studio which is why im so glad to see you giving these guys credit. This will bring to the visual studio express family significant new capabilities that weve made available in visual studio 2012 for building great desktop applications. We write a separate test case for each of the browsers mentioned above. Use test explorer to run unit tests from visual studio or thirdparty unit test projects. Compared that to the experience of a college kid who may start programming with just a lightweight text editor on a mac. This project contains the visual studio runner for.

Breakpoints do not hit correctly in unit test developer. Visual studio to define and run unit tests to maintain code health, ensure code coverage, and find errors and faults before your customers do. Developer community for visual studio product family. If you have visual studio community or a paidfor version of visual studio, you can run your tests within visual studios builtin test runner named test explorer. If you have not given visual studio code a spin you really should, especially if you are doing webjavascriptnode development. Testing and debugging an interactive xslt debugger is included with intellij idea 11 for debugging xslt. Sql server database unit testing in your devops pipeline. One super awesome feature of vs code is the ability to easily configure the ability to debug your jest should work just fine with other javascript testing frameworks tests.

The nunittestadapter extension works with the visual studio unit test window to allow integrated test execution under visual studio 2012, 20, 2015 and 2017. Net developers trained in microsoft visual studio to stay within their preferred ide, and use their existing skills and extensive. If your tests dont appear in visual studio, the first thing to try is closing your solution and then reopening them. These efforts involved frameworks and tooling for both. Instead of starting the wordcount app project, ctrlclick the test library project, and select start debugging project from the context menu. Open the solution that contains the code you want to test. You may need to click the build button black triangle in upperleft to see your new tests. Quick info tool tips let you inspect api definitions. Getting started in visual studio for mac nunitdocs wiki. Visual studio 2017 editions are tailored to specific team needs and sizes, as well as the roles of individual team members. Run your unit tests frequently to make sure your code is working properly.

To get started, you can create a file named nsettings in your unit test project to hold the same settings you use in visual studio. Use the visual studio debugger to quickly find and fix bugs across languages. Get started with unit testing visual studio microsoft docs. Microsoft visual studio 2019 develop apps for android, ios, mac, windows, web, and cloud. Ntvs offers git and microsoft visual studio team foundation server integration as well as project. Squiggly lines in the editor highlight issues in real time as you type.

Visual studio 2019 for mac a free and fullfeatured solution for individual developers to create applications for android, ios, macos, cloud and the web. The integrated test runner supports major testing frameworks such as xunit, nunit, and mstest, allowing you to efficiently run and debug unit. This guide assumes that you have a solution with either a pcl or a shared project and a number of platform specific projects. You can also use test explorer to group tests into categories, filter the test list, and create, save, and run playlists of tests. In this tutorial, you configure visual studio code on macos to use the clangllvm compiler and debugger. Unfortunately, this does not include express editions of visual studio you should upgrade to the free community edition instead. Go ahead and create a regular class and add a couple tests against it. Visual studio 2010 product key is an integrated environment that simplifies creating, debugging and deploying packages.

This section describes how to create a unit test project. Unit testing fundamentals visual studio microsoft docs. It supports the builtin test explorer feature in visual studio 2012 and later all editions except express. Initially ported from junit, the current production release, version 3, has been completely rewritten with many new features and support for a wide range of. Visual studio for mac starts your test project with the debugger attached. This site uses cookies for analytics, personalized content and ads. Comparison of leading it management software solutions. The coderush includes the visual studio intellisense addon intellirush. Visual studio professional, visual studio enterprise, visual studio test professional and msdn platforms. In the current version of visual studio for mac there is add file template for xunit unittests.

If you cant see the unit test pane or pad as they call it on the mac, open it now. If youre using visual studio for mac the nunit templates extension cant be used. Unleash your creativity and convey your vision to lifestyles with useful design surfaces and following collaboration strategies for builders and designers. So you can create a new test case with a previously existing recording or you can create a new recording. Visual studio test explorer provides a flexible and efficient way to run your unit tests and view their results in visual studio. This works for both firefox and chrome js debuggers. Developer express inc is proud to announce the immediate availability of its newest release, devexpress v19. There have been several significant improvements to the test experience that range across visual studio and visual studio team services. Visual studio 2019 for mac ide for macos microsoft. Use a unit testing framework to create unit tests, run them, and report the results of these tests. How to unit test using visual studio for mac its easy. Microsoft announces visual studio 2019 venturebeat.

The visual studio for mac debugger lets you step inside your code by setting breakpoints, step over statements, step into and out of functions, and inspect the current state of the code stack through powerful visualizations. In update 3, can you bring back the icons from visual studio 2010, get rid of the all caps menus and fire whomever did the design work in the first place. Use an easy sidebyside layout to quickly compare their features, pricing and integrations. Compare code blocks vs visual studio ide 2020 financesonline. Visual studio express was supplanted by the visual studio community edition, which is also available for free, but with a different license. Unit testing, meanwhile, is enabled via integration with visual studios test explorer capability. Microsoft launched visual studio 2017 in march 2017 and visual studio 2017 for mac in may 2017, and says it has become our most popular visual studio release ever. Visual studio 2010 product key crack free download. Using visual studio to develop linux apps visualgdb. Run and debug unit tests with test explorer visual studio. With the power of roslyn, visual studio for mac brings intellisense to your fingertips.

285 549 236 298 11 1265 1042 1609 755 535 872 779 283 1487 88 576 561 995 1494 1297 1091 946 1341 1277 1494 1252 912 179 917 240 317 1313 264 1609 320 1267 795 441 252 1459 971 702 1336 250 1323